How MIPS and board certification work
The Merit-based Incentive Payment System (MIPS) scores providers 0–100 across four performance categories: Quality, Cost, Promoting Interoperability, and Improvement Activities, weighted under 42 CFR §414.1380. Reporting is voluntary for many small practices, so absence of a MIPS score is not a quality signal.
Board certification through an ABMS or AOA member board signals voluntary post-licensure examination plus continuous Maintenance of Certification cycles. Verify any individual provider's status through certificationmatters.org (ABMS) or osteopathic.org (AOA).
John Ellyn, MD appears in the CMS NPPES registry as a Specialist provider holding MD credentials at 31 SMITH ST, Charleston, SC, 29401, with a listed phone of (843) 577-6506. NPI 1952394330 was issued on 08/31/2005.
Medicare Part D records for calendar year 2023 show 826 prescription claims written by this provider, covering 193 Medicare beneficiaries and totaling roughly $115K in drug spend, split 29% brand-name and 71% generic by claim count.
Specialist is a high-volume specialty nationwide, with 69,608 enrolled providers across 55 states and an average of 1,474 Part D claims per prescriber, so the context for interpreting these metrics differs meaningfully from a primary-care baseline.

Data Sources
View source datasets and methodology notes
- Provider Directory
- CMS National Plan and Provider Enumeration System (NPPES), download.cms.gov/nppes, updated monthly. Contains NPI, specialty, credentials, and practice location.
- Specialty Classification
- NUCC Health Care Provider Taxonomy (nucc.org), the industry standard for classifying provider specialties in Medicare and Medicaid billing.
- Prescribing Data
- CMS Medicare Part D Prescriber Public Use File (2023). Includes claims, drug costs, beneficiaries, and opioid prescribing rates.
- Limitations
- Provider data is self-reported to CMS. Prescribing data reflects Medicare Part D only and does not include commercial insurance, Medicaid, or cash prescriptions. Claims below 11 beneficiaries are suppressed by CMS for privacy.
